Output 51ddaafb083d2b229c11aa848f21dbe82cda356410906672a9cb1940916d14a3:81
- value
- 44095
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807098b8674dbe2560eeb328d54032ba78c18b87 OP_EQUAL
- address
- 3DQ9JSjPPgWUqwaH3QVRtptNBu5Z4UQtPA
- transaction
- 51ddaafb083d2b229c11aa848f21dbe82cda356410906672a9cb1940916d14a3
- confirmations
- 227983
- spent
- true